Hindsight is 20-20
As I have prayed over the decades, I have kept hundreds of journals. I have written hundreds of these pages in all kinds of journals over the years. But what is interesting, as I look back, the journals are the same journals year after year after year.
Even though the subjects, life situations and life’s circumstances have always been constantly changing – the one thing that has never changed is that God has ALWAYS ALWAYS ALWAYS answered my prayers and most of all – he has done more for me and has answered me in ways far beyond what I could have ever asked for or even thought of.
The one scripture….
The one scripture that I have posted on my office wall and several other places at home and work is”…
Ephesians 3 Now unto him who is able to do immeasurably more than all we ask or imagine according to his power that is at work within us. To Him be glory in the church and in Christ Jesus throughout all generations for ever and ever Amen.
I have spent decades praying. Sometimes praying through the good times and other times praying through the not so good times. BUT… the one thing that I have always learned is that after I have prayed with my limited knowledge of what I believed that God wanted to do for me – and after I shared all of my personal dreams and visions with God – he always answers me far above and beyond my own dreams and visions, in ways that I could have ever asked, dreamed or even imagined.
When I limit God to what only I can think, dream or imagine? Then I have already limited God and I sidelined my expectation from him. When I have limited his word, I once again have already limited his blessing to me and everyone that he wants to bless through me..
